In June 2016, as part of the Open Government Action Plan, the Treasury Board of Canada Secretariat (TBS) committed to increasing the transparency and usefulness of grants and contribution data and subsequently launched the Guidelines on the Reporting of Grants and Contributions Awards, effective April 1, 2018.
The rules and principles governing government grants and contributions are outlined in the Treasury Board Policy on Transfer Payments. Transfer payments are transfers of money, goods, services or assets made from an appropriation to individuals, organizations or other levels of government, without the federal government directly receiving goods or services in return, but which may require the recipient to provide a report or other information subsequent to receiving payment. These expenditures are reported in the Public Accounts of Canada. The major types of transfer payments are grants, contributions and \'other transfer payments\'.
Included in this category, but not to be reported under proactive disclosure of awards, are (1) transfers to other levels of government such as Equalization payments as well as Canada Health and Social Transfer payments. (2) Grants and contributions reallocated or otherwise redistributed by the recipient to third parties; and (3) information that would normally be withheld under the Access to Information Act and the Privacy Act.

Developing of reagent combinations for the visual detection of SARS-CoV-2
955496
The team proposes to develop a molecular assay that identifies SARS-CoV-2 from saliva by a color change in 30 minutes. This assay consists of reagents that will amplify the SARS-CoV-2 genetic material 10 thousand fold. The amplified genetic material will bind to 13-nm gold nanoparticles coated with complementary single stranded DNA. The color of the solution changes because the gold nanoparticle will be assembled onto the SARS-CoV-2 amplified gene. The clustering of the gold nanoparticle changes how the electrons are moving, leading to different absorbance properties. This can be visualized by the change in the color of the solution of gold nanoparticles from red to blue. A positive detection is when the solution is blue. The team proposes to develop a formulation consisting of enzymes, salts, and gold nanoparticle-conjugates.

Augmented reality system with AI modules for efficient remote guidance of drones
955579
This Project aims at developing a system for the remote guidance of drones that will integrate artificial intelligence (AI) tools and generic augmented reality (AR) to improve drone capabilities to carry out complex tasks related to transportation. Drones can be remotely guided by an expert or a team of technicians that could be located anywhere, and the system will allow for efficient on-site, on-time inspection and delivery, and thus quick and efficient intervention and remote guidance. In the recent years, unmanned aerial vehicles (UAV), and especially drones, have emerged as one of the most promising technologies in civil applications such as infrastructure inspection and maintenance, environmental surveillance and monitoring and transportation. In the transportation domain, drones can play a central role in ensuring remote and rapid parcel or medical supply delivery and infrastructure inspection (e.g., roads, rails, cardo vessels, stations, ports, airports).
However, one of the main issues that can hinder the large-scale utilisation of drones is the difficulty of ensuring a robust and rapid interaction to a complex and dynamic environment and reacting to hazardous situations that can disrupt tasks and safe
navigation (e.g., difficult terrain, weather conditions, obstacles, power lines).
